How they compare
Turkey currently reports 244.17 hectares against 238.38 hectares in Iraq, a difference of 5.79 hectares.
The two have swapped places 6 times across 15 shared years of data; in 2012 it was Turkey ahead.
Iraq ranks 99th and Turkey ranks 96th of 181 countries.
Turkey has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
The average area burnt per wildfire, in hectares. The 2026 data is incomplete and was last updated 07 August 2026.
